Power outages kill mountain phone lines
Q: What are some of the issues people are experiencing with the power outages and the battery backups?
Residents described that the backups, installed by CenturyLink now Lumen Technologies, fail to keep essential services running during outages, creating dangerous situations when fires, snowstorms, or planned outages occur.
Power outages kill mountain phone lines
Q: This was a project for your CU News Corps, right? Could you give us a quick high level synopsis of what this story is about?
The students explained that aging battery backups installed by telecom providers in western Boulder County are not reliably keeping landlines and emergency services online during outages, which affects vulnerable residents and prompts officials to demand upgrades and systemic changes.

Frequently Asked Questions About The Mountain-Ear Podcast

What is The Mountain-Ear Podcast about and what kind of topics does it cover?

This show covers a mix of local news, culture, and community stories from Colorado's Peak to Peak region, with a strong emphasis on music, local events, and civic issues. Episodes often feature in-depth conversations with local musicians, small-town leaders, health and public-interest experts, and community organizers, weaving personal stories with practical updates for residents and visitors. Noteworthy is the consistent focus on regional identity, resilience, and collaborative problem-solving—whether spotlighting new musical projects, restoration efforts, or town governance—making it a valuable resource for listeners who want a grounded view of Colorado's mountain towns and their vibrant communities.
